The “Will Way”(Addressed to Adrian from Hereafter)

You would like to leave 10% of the strawberry farm, worth $1M, to Silver & Black Give Back in your will.

The other 90% of the farm would go to Diego.

Page 9: Adrian J. Contreras' Charitable Gift

The “Will Way” Under the Will idea,

Silver & Black Give Back would get $100,000 worth of land when you die.

Diego would get $900,000 worth of land. Seems like a good idea for Deigo!

Page 10: Adrian J. Contreras' Charitable Gift

But wait…. Uncle Sam would take

$360,000 from Diego because of a 40% estate tax.

This would leave Diego with $540,000 worth of land from the strawberry farm.

My proposal: Give a remainder interest in the strawberry farm

to Silver and Black Give Back.

This gift will result in $139,450.32 in money saved from the current income taxes you owe.

You currently owe in $353,045.75 in federal income tax.

Page 12: Adrian J. Contreras' Charitable Gift

Your Deduction You may only deduct up to 50% of your income

according to the IRS.

Page 13: Adrian J. Contreras' Charitable Gift

The Value of Your Gift Given your age and life

expectancy, the IRS would value your gift at $352,170

This would be a gift you could make under IRS regulations.

The Irrevocable Life Insurance Trust (ILIT)

You could purchase an ILIT to avoid present and estate taxes for you and Diego.

You could only gift $14,000 a year to do this; here is how.

Page 16: Adrian J. Contreras' Charitable Gift

The Insurance Policy State Farm’s Life Insurance Policy Calculator

estimates that it would cost you $788.78/mo; $9,066.43/ yr for 15 years to purchase $581,705 of coverage.

This is $41,705 more in asserts than Diego would receive if you were to leave him 90% of the Strawberry farm in his will.
